I have seen innumerable references to my 2013 Avalon Limited having an HDD based Navigation system, but I am unable to find anything in the Navigation manual, or online, that indicates where the hard disk drive is actually located in the car. I am assuming it is not user accessible, but I am curious to know where it is. I suppose the answer is "somewhere behind the dashboard." Can anyone do better than that?

I was at the dealer today and asked. The service writer (not a tech) said it was under the head unit; attached to it but not part of it. He gave me the impression that it was mounted on the head unit.
It seems that my guess of "somewhere behind the dashboard" is pretty much correct.
